## Image Slimming Provenance

Plugin authors targeting the Quillbase runtime should note that all published container images pass through the Slimjack stripping stage, which removes debug symbols, docs, and unused locales. The final layer digest is signed by the Quillbase release pipeline. The trace token for the current slimmed base image appears below.

pipeline stamp: htk9_fa6ea24b2

## Build provenance: checkout load tests

Hey on-call — if the Pinwheel checkout flow starts acting up after a load run, don't guess which build got hammered. Every soak test we fire at staging stamps its artifacts with a provenance record, so you can trace a spike straight back to the exact build and config. Grab the record from the Lodestone dashboard and compare timestamps. The most recent certified load-test build is identified by the token below.

session token of bawep-yadup = htk21_528abd376e3c5a4ec24a1

Subject: Key rotation — Quickfill index service

On-call: autocomplete latency on Quickfill is tracked to the stale index shard on node petrel-4. Reindex is scheduled for 02:00 UTC; expect degraded suggestions until then. As part of the fix we rotated the Quickfill indexer credentials, since the old key was shared with the deprecated batch loader. Old key dies at rotation time. Update the indexer config and restart the worker pool before the window closes. The new key for the Quickfill index service is below.

app token of yagaf-bahop = vxb2-4d